Mind Enterprises and Joe Killington Reimagine 80s Disco with ‘Up & Down’

“Up & Down,” the latest release from Mind Enterprises and Joe Killington, is pure bliss. This summery disco anthem takes you straight back to the vibrant 80s, but with a modern twist. The track blends nostalgic beats with fresh production, creating a vibe that’s both familiar and exciting. Joe Killington’s smooth vocals glide over a groovy bassline, perfectly capturing the essence of classic disco in this cover of Billy More’s “Up & Down.” The chorus is irresistibly catchy, repeating “up & down” in a way that sticks with you long after the song ends. The upbeat tempo makes it impossible not to dance. “Up & Down” allows you to let loose and soak in the summer vibes.

Mind Enterprises is the brainchild of Andrea Tirone, a Turin-born producer who was raised on the synth-powered Italo disco of the 80s. Tirone’s work is a mix of groovy basslines, hypnotic drum patterns, and cosmic keyboard melodies. Through his visuals, he adds a touch of humor, poking fun at consumerism and the silliness of the 80s. Over the past year, Mind Enterprises has been hitting the live circuit, playing at festivals like Mallorca Live and Reeperbahn, as well as headlining shows in Germany, Switzerland, and The Netherlands.

Joe Killington is a British singer and songwriter known for his soulful voice and versatile style. He’s collaborated with various artists across genres, including dance, pop, and electronic music. Killington’s powerful vocals have been featured on several hit tracks, making him one to watch in the music scene.
